I'm not familiar with the case, but it seems to me that if the
finding is correct that Aimster choose their name "because of the
popularity" of AIM (thus intentionally trying to confuse their
trademark with a trademark of another company) the verdict was
correct.
Like if the founders last name or initials are AIM or there was any
other good reason for the choice of the name, I would indeed think it
horrible, but from reading that article that doesn't seem to be the
case.
